I know many of us have long been in prayer regarding what is about to transpire in St. Louis at the Special General Conference, and for the people who will gather there to make a decision. Let’s very deliberately continue those prayers.

This Saturday is the opening day for GC2019. It is a day dedicated to worship and prayer. As much as possible, we should join them in Spirit. My own local church is making it possible for people to come to the sanctuary Saturday and join in prayer, and I hope many other local churches have similar plans.

There is much we can be praying. We certainly need to be praying for the health of the delegates. Travel is difficult for many of them, it is a season of virulent illnesses, and the stress levels will be high. Let’s be sure to cover them in prayers for safety and continuing wellness.

I want to offer a particular prayer focus, one with two basic points.

May the Spirit fall on the conference in an undeniable way. We believe God intervenes directly when the body willingly seeks guidance. It is my prayer that every single delegate will know without a doubt God provided guidance during this Conference. Come, Holy Spirit, come!

As the Spirit falls, may peace reign. Emotions are running high. People feel their worldviews and their ways of defining how to relate to God are threatened. Whatever happens, may it happen in a peaceful, orderly manner. As Jesus said, “Peace be with you.”
